## Version 1.2.0: The Shiny + Sprites Update Published 2026 05 24 Major image server upgrade: switched main API from https://chiy.uk/ to the more robust https://pokeapi.co/ which enables shinies and gen based sprites. The old image server is now used as a fallback. Shiny mode: off, on (default), all. On means that if a pokepaste pokemon contains "Shiny: Yes" in it's text, the extension will swap in the shiny artwork. All replaces every single image with it's shiny art. Off means it doesn't run, the default behavior of pokepaste. Sprites mode: off or on (default). The pokeapi gives us access to sprite artwork for older generations (1-5). When turned on, the extension will look for the format tag, for example "gen1ou", which will resolve to gen 1 and the pokemon yellow sprites replacing all the images. Works with shinies for gens 2-5. Name colours. Now the pokemon's name and nickname will be the color of their primary type, just like how pokepaste works by default for pokemon without missing images. ## Version 1.1.1 Published 2026 04 12 Added all the new Pokemon Legends ZA Mega Pokemon alongside the launch of Pokemon Champions.
